611 Bender Rd is a 1,754 square foot house on a 0.29 acre lot with 4 bedrooms and 1.5 bathrooms. Based on Redfin's West Bend data, we estimate the home's value is $316,295.

Zoning
RS-3
Single Family Residential District
The RS-3 SingleFamily Residential District is intended to provide a suitable living environment for medium sized lot, low density single-family housing. It is further intended to promote any environment free from other incompatible uses and the detrimental affects of those uses.
